Right targets
The idea that the wealthy should pay for NhS treatment has been put forward.
They already do — it’s called National Insurance.
The group using NhS services the most is the group that doesn’t, or rarely, pays NI — those who abuse substances, eat junk food and don’t take exercise.
If we need to target groups, we should focus on getting people back to work.
